2. 7KA Front Wheel Specifications You Shouldn’t Miss

Spec sheets aren’t just for tech nerds – they help you understand how a wheel will perform under pressure.

The 7KA Front Wheel makes it one of the best options for riders who push their gear to the limit.

Hub Specifications:

odyssey vandero pro front hub with plastic guards

  • Shell material: 7075-T6 Aluminum
  • Bearings: 6903RS Sealed Cartridge
  • Axle: 7075-T6 Aluminum with Steel Helicoil Thread Inserts (Female)
  • Axle bolts: Heat-Treated Chromoly (3/8″) (17mm Wrench or 6mm Hex)
  • Extras: Replaceable Hub Guard (x2)
  • Color: Black
  • Weight: 11.2 oz (317.5 g)

Rim Specifications:

odyssey 7ka rim features

  • Material: 7000 Series Aluminum
  • Rim joint: Welded
  • Width (external): 34mm
  • Height: 17mm
  • ERD: 390
  • Color: Black
  • Weight: 17.3 oz (490 g)

Wheel Build:

  • Spoke count: 36H
  • Spoke color: Black
  • Nipple color: Silver

Price: $244.99

3. Real-World Performance

odyssey 7ka front wheel performance

The 7KA Front Wheel feels tight and ready to SHRED.

Thanks to the sealed bearings, the Vandero Pro hub spins super smooth, while the sturdy 7KA rim keeps things true even after repeated heavy landings.

Grind lovers will appreciate the included hub guards, which protect flanges and spokes from abuse from ledges and rails.

Whether you’re nose-bonking a ledge, slamming into stair sets, or simply bombing the park, this front wheel holds its own without question.

It’s an amazing, all-terrain BMX front wheel that you can use for serious riding.
